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2535118 4055056217 5916
76020 59
76020 59
395 699 290017109 12 3269929279
All about undefined
Interested in learning more?
76020 59
395 699 290017109 12 3269929279
See more
5561220553 3967 5286
76426 245 2699574
See more
950 202 4366
44881 004373094 91 6950326
See more